WebA budget is a structured list of your personal or household expected income and expenses. It’s to help you plan for how, what for and how much money will be spent or saved during a particular period of time. A great … WebTotal monthly expenses: This is the total amount of money you’re spending each month. Your goal is to make sure your expenses are less than your income so that you’re not relying on savings or debt to get by. Percentages of your budget: The pie chart shows the percentage of your budget each expense eats up. A full 50% of your income should be … WebThe following steps can help you create a budget. Step 1: Calculate your net income The foundation of an effective budget is your net income. That’s your take-home pay—total wages or salary minus deductions for taxes and employer-provided programs such as retirement plans and health insurance.

Join the … first time mom hospital bag checklistWebA budget helps you decide: what you must spend your money on. if you can spend less money on some things and more money on other things. For example, your budget might show that you spend $100 on clothes every month. You might decide you can spend $50 on clothes.
